Package is "python-PyInstaller" Thu Mar 5 17:29:58 2026 rev:16 rq:1336683 version:6.19.0 Changes: -------- --- /work/SRC/openSUSE:Factory/python-PyInstaller/python-PyInstaller.changes 2025-11-19 14:59:38.990636528 +0100 +++ /work/SRC/openSUSE:Factory/.python-PyInstaller.new.561/python-PyInstaller.changes 2026-03-05 17:32:19.501376343 +0100 @@ -1,0 +2,37 @@ +Thu Mar 5 08:19:15 UTC 2026 - Dirk Müller <[email protected]> + +- update to 6.19.0: + * Implement support for Tcl/Tk 9 in splash screen. + (:issue:`9313`) + * (macOS) Improve the .framework bundle fix-up code to remove + file entries that would be placed under restored symlinked + directories. This fixes file-already-exists errors at build + time (onedir) or run-time (onefile) when user or a hook tries + to collect (all) files from a package that ships a .framework + bundle with symlinks mangled into hard-copies (for example, + due to lack of symlink support in PyPI wheels). + (:issue:`9335`) + * Have hook for stdlib platform module exclude the _ios_support + module when sys.platform != 'ios'. This prevents unnecessary + collection of ctypes-imported libobjc shared library if the + latter happens to be available on the build system. + (:issue:`9333`) + * Update scipy hook for compatibility with scipy 1.17.0. + (:issue:`9353`) + * Avoid indirect usage of pkg_resources which is deprecated and + scheduled to be removed in 2025-11-30. (:issue:`9149`) + * Revise the search for Python shared library from + :issue:`9218` and the restrictions it imposes: enable the + fall-back codepath with guess-based name for all Python + builds that report Py_ENABLE_SHARED=0 instead of just for + Anaconda Python (compat.is_conda), but limit the search paths + in this fall-back codepath to only sys.base_prefix and the + lib directory under it. (:issue:`9276`) + * Work around performance issues introduced by superfluous + usage of :func:`gc.collect` in pefile==2024.8.26. PyInstaller + no longer blocks :installing pefile==2024.8.26. + (:issue:`8762`) + * Fix finding setuptools's vendored copies of backports and + jaraco packages. (:issue:`9250`) + +------------------------------------------------------------------- Old: ---- pyinstaller-6.16.0.tar.gz New: ---- pyinstaller-6.19.0.tar.gz 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 Other differences: ------------------ ++++++ python-PyInstaller.spec ++++++ --- /var/tmp/diff_new_pack.1PJRZM/_old 2026-03-05 17:32:20.165403960 +0100 +++ /var/tmp/diff_new_pack.1PJRZM/_new 2026-03-05 17:32:20.169404127 +0100 @@ -1,7 +1,7 @@ # # spec file for package python-PyInstaller # -# Copyright (c) 2025 SUSE LLC and contributors +# Copyright (c) 2026 SUSE LLC and contributors # # All modifications and additions to the file contributed by third parties # remain the property of their copyright owners, unless otherwise agreed @@ -20,7 +20,7 @@ %bcond_without test %define modname PyInstaller Name: python-PyInstaller -Version: 6.16.0 +Version: 6.19.0 Release: 0 Summary: Bundle a Python application and all its dependencies into a single package License: GPL-2.0-only ++++++ pyinstaller-6.16.0.tar.gz -> pyinstaller-6.19.0.tar.gz ++++++ ++++ 3242 lines of diff (skipped)
